<p>I built a weather and hurricane tracking site for the Eastern Caribbean islands (<a href="https://dewedda.com" rel="nofollow">https://dewedda.com</a>). PHP, MySQL, Cloudflare, Visual Crossing API, Leaflet.js for maps.<p>The interesting part wasn't the stack. It was realizing how much the interpretation layer matters when you're building for a specific region. Wind descriptions, "feels like" calculations, condition summaries, all tuned for temperate climates by default. I've been reworking them for the Eastern Caribbean audience.<p>Wrote about what I learned: <a href="https://hydn.dev/82-degrees-feels-like/" rel="nofollow">https://hydn.dev/82-degrees-feels-like/</a></p>
